Ani Traykova
I use the app on Android, and it is not making my life easier. Regular glitching, no option to change editions, the scanner with the camera does not work, & most of the times I have to type in the isbn to get the correct edition. Notifications are a mess, too. I get those sometimes, but not when it is for comments on updates. Tried using the Web version in a desktop mode, but it keeps jumping to the app instead. At this point, I am just frustrated with the app and think of switching to another.

The basic functions this app is designed for are broken. People use GR to track their books, yet the tracking does not work. The shelving is bugged - displaying books in both TBR and Read, showing incorrect number of books read this year, etc. I recommend anyone having issues with Good Reads to migrate to Storygraph, as their shelving actually works, you can choose which edition you're reading for more accurate stats, and you get fun graphs too!
